π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Cut each squash in half lengthwise.

Remove seeds.

Peel and cut into 1/2-inch slices.

Arrange in a lightly greased 8 x 12 x 2-inch baking dish. Top with apple slices.

Combine remaining ingredients, mixing well. Spoon over apple slices.

Cover and bake at 350Β° for 1 hour and 15 minutes or until squash is tender. Makes 6 to 8 servings.
